Volunteer at animal shelters

Animal shelters are always in need of volunteers to help with different tasks. Some common tasks include walking dogs, feeding animals, cleaning cages, and providing love and comfort to the animals. Taking your pets to the vet

If you're like many pet owners, you probably feel guilty when you have to take your animal to the veterinarian. But taking your pet to the vet is important – it's just like taking your child to the doctor. Veterinarians are experts in animal care and can treat your pet for a wide variety of issues, from simple vaccinations to more serious problems. Here are some ways to get involved with pet owners in your city and help make their visits to the vet more affordable and convenient:
• Join a local pet-owners' organization. These organizations can provide you with information about local clinics and services, as well as offer occasional discounts on veterinary bills.
• Advocate for better public health policies that support preventive healthcare for pets. For example, make sure your municipality offers low-cost or free rabies vaccines for all pets.
• Donate money or supplies to local veterinary clinics that serve low-income families or animals in need. These clinics often depend on donations from people like you who appreciate the work they do
